site stats

Rocksdb clock cache

Web27 Jun 2024 · Instead of using a separate block cache for each RocksDB instance, we use 1 global block cache for all RocksDB instances on the leaf node. This helps achieve better … WebThe cache is sharded. // to 2^num_shard_bits shards, by hash of the key. The total capacity. // is divided and evenly assigned to each shard. If strict_capacity_limit. // is set, insert to …

rocksdb_use_clock_cache — MariaDB Enterprise …

Web26 May 2024 · NO. It means the block cache will cost 2.5GB, and the in-memory table will cost 64 * 3MB, since there are 3 (opts.max_write_buffer_number) buffers, each is of size … Web22 Sep 2024 · On each store() call data points are accumulated in minute buckets stored in the cache, while on-disk persistence happens periodically in a background job. Each run of … how many indian companies in fortune 500 https://brucecasteel.com

RocksDB in Microsoft Bing Engineering Blog

WebRocksDB uses a LRU cache for blocks to serve reads. The block cache is partitioned into two individual caches: the first caches uncompressed blocks and the second caches … WebIf the data block is not found in block cache, RocksDB reads it from file using buffered IO. That means it also uses page cache -- it contains raw compressed blocks. In a way, … WebThe benchmark results look awesome at first sight, but we quickly realized that those results were for a database whose size was smaller than the size of RAM on the test machine – … howard gardner ap psychology

MyRocks System Variables - MariaDB Knowledge Base

Category:File: rocksdb_use_clock_cache_basic.result Debian Sources

Tags:Rocksdb clock cache

Rocksdb clock cache

跟着Rocskdb 学 存储引擎:读写链路的代码极致优化 - 知乎

WebRocksDB provides a way for those instances to share block cache and thread pool. To share block cache, assign a single cache object to all instances: … WebRocksDB is managing memtable, block cache, indexes and bloom filters, and interacting with the operating system for resources. There may also be congestion because of …

Rocksdb clock cache

Did you know?

Web21 Dec 2024 · The rocksdb code doesn't actually seem to expose these stats. Are there any other recommended ways of tracking down memory usage? Setting … Web18 Jan 2024 · What is RocksDB? Thinking of RocksDB as a distributed database that needs to run on a cluster and to be managed by specialized administrators is a common …

Webrocksdb_. block_. cache_. size. This page is part of MariaDB's MariaDB Documentation. The parent of this page is: System Variables for MariaDB Enterprise Server. Topics on this … WebBlock Cache is a way for RocksDB to cache data in memory to improve read performance. Developers can create a cache object and indicate the cache capacity, which is then …

WebSee the AUTHORS file for names of contributors. #include "cache/clock_cache.h" #ifndef SUPPORT_CLOCK_CACHE namespace ROCKSDB_NAMESPACE ... { // Clock cache not … Web18 Jun 2024 · blockCacheSize=1350 * 1024 * 1024. Does not necessarily mean that the rocksDB memory is restricted to 1350MB. If the application has e.g. 8 stream partitions …

Web1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21--source include/have_rocksdb.inc CREATE TABLE valid_values (value varchar(255)) ENGINE=myisam; INSERT INTO valid ...

Web27 May 2024 · RocksDB Secondary Cache Posted May 27, 2024 Introduction The RocksDB team is implementing support for a block cache on non-volatile media, such as a local … how many indian have bank accountWebrocksdb_ use_ clock_ cache This page is part of MariaDB's MariaDB Documentation. The parent of this page is: System Variables for MariaDB Enterprise Server Topics on this … howard gardner changing mindsWebBlock Cache about Rocksdb Block cache is used for Compressed and Uncompressed Data. RocksDB uses a LRU cache for blocks to serve reads. The block cache is partitioned into … howard gardner biographyWeb21 Jun 2024 · By default index and filter blocks are cached outside of block cache. Users can configure RocksDB to include index and filter blocks into the block cache to better … how many indian elephants are leftWeb10 Mar 2024 · RocksDB is a storage engine library that implements a key-value interface where keys and values are arbitrary bytes. All data is organized in sorted order by the key. … how many indian gods are thereWeb27 Mar 2014 · The interface between RocksDB’s block cache and the secondary cache is designed to allow pluggable implementations. For FB internal usage, we plan to use Cachelib with a wrapper to provide the plug-in implementation and use folly and other fbcode libraries, which cannot be used directly by RocksDB, to efficiently implement the cache operations. howard gardner and forest schoolWeb25 Apr 2024 ·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site howard gardner biography summary